And to do that, you’ll need the 3 Level 3 Fire Fist monsters from Cosmo Blazer!
Brotherhood of the Fire Fist – Hawk may look weak at first since it only has 1500 DEF, but its effect gives all of your Fire Fist monsters – including itself – an additional 500 ATK and DEF as long as you have at least 1 Fire Formation Spell or Trap Card on your field. Plus, if your opponent manages to overcome your Hawk’s 2000 DEF and destroy it, Hawk’s other effect will activate. If it’s destroyed by an opponent’s card, either in battle or by a card effect, Hawk lets you Set a Fire Formation Spell Card from your Deck. Obviously, this can get Fire Formation – Tenki which can then get you a new Fire Fist monster like Brotherhood of the Fire Fist – Bear. Multiple copies stack up of course, and there’s an easy way to make that happen that we’ll talk about next week.
Brotherhood of the Fire Fist – Raven has 1800 DEF and makes all of your Fire Formations indestructible. As long as Raven is on your field, face-up Fire Formation Spell and Trap Cards you control cannot be destroyed by your opponent’s card effects. Raven’s second effect lets you Set a Fire Formation Spell Card from your Deck if it’s sent to the Graveyard. Note that Raven doesn’t need to be sent to the Graveyard by your opponent’s card effect to activate its effect. Even if you use Raven in a Synchro Summon, its effect will give you a Fire Formation Spell Card. By combining the powers of Raven and Hawk, you make the equivalent of a steel wall with flamethrowers in front that slowly advances towards your opponent’s Life Points.
Brotherhood of the Fire Fist – Spirit is the last of the Level 3 Fire Fists in Cosmo Blazer. Spirit’s effect lets you Special Summon a Level 3 FIRE monster with 200 DEF or less from your Graveyard when it’s Normal Summoned. If you do, Spirit stops you from attacking with any monster that isn’t a Beast-Warrior for the rest of the turn; but since all of the best monsters in Fire Fist Decks are Beast-Warriors, that’s not really a sacrifice.
Spirit only has 200 DEF, so it can Special Summon a second copy of itself with its effect, setting up a quick Rank 3 Xyz Summon. In addition, Spirit is a Tuner monster that can be used to make Beast-Warrior Synchro Monsters. This helps to expand the number of plays you can make with Spirit.
